Advanced Diagnostics

AI’s prowess in processing vast amounts of medical data at unprecedented speeds has significantly enhanced diagnostic capabilities. Machine learning algorithms analyze medical images, such as X-rays and MRIs, with remarkable accuracy, aiding in the early detection of diseases. This not only expedites diagnosis but also contributes to more effective treatment strategies.

Personalized Treatment Plans

One of the most promising aspects of AI in healthcare is its ability to tailor treatment plans based on individual patient data. Machine learning algorithms consider a patient’s genetic makeup, medical history, and lifestyle factors to recommend personalized interventions. This approach not only improves treatment outcomes but also minimizes the risk of adverse reactions.

Drug Discovery and Development

AI is streamlining the drug discovery process, making it more efficient and cost-effective. By analyzing vast datasets, AI algorithms identify potential drug candidates, predict their efficacy, and even anticipate side effects. This accelerates the development of new medications, bringing innovative therapies to patients more rapidly.

Remote Patient Monitoring

The advent of wearable devices and IoT technology, coupled with AI, enables continuous remote monitoring of patients. From tracking vital signs to analyzing daily activity patterns, AI facilitates real-time health assessments. This not only empowers individuals to actively participate in their healthcare but also allows healthcare providers to intervene proactively.

Virtual Health Assistants

AI-powered virtual health assistants are changing the way patients interact with the healthcare system. These intelligent chatbots and voice-activated assistants provide instant information, answer queries, and even schedule appointments. This not only enhances patient engagement but also reduces the burden on healthcare staff, allowing them to focus on more complex tasks.

Operational Efficiency

AI is optimizing healthcare operations, streamlining administrative tasks, and improving overall efficiency. From appointment scheduling to billing and coding, automation powered by AI reduces administrative burdens, allowing healthcare professionals to allocate more time to patient care.

Ethical Considerations

As we embrace the benefits of AI in healthcare, it’s crucial to address ethical concerns. Privacy, security, and the responsible use of patient data are paramount. Striking a balance between technological advancements and ethical considerations is essential to ensure the trust and well-being of patients.

Natural Language Processing in Healthcare

AI’s natural language processing (NLP) capabilities are revolutionizing the way healthcare professionals handle vast amounts of unstructured data in medical records and research papers. By extracting valuable insights from textual information, NLP contributes to more informed decision-making and improved patient outcomes.

Predictive Analytics for Disease Prevention

AI’s predictive analytics models leverage historical data to identify patterns and trends, enabling healthcare providers to anticipate disease outbreaks and proactively implement preventive measures. This data-driven approach enhances public health initiatives and contributes to more effective disease prevention strategies.

Augmented Reality (AR) in Surgical Procedures

The integration of AI with augmented reality is enhancing surgical precision and training. Surgeons can use AR to visualize patient anatomy in real-time, improving accuracy during procedures. Additionally, AI algorithms can provide guidance and suggestions, augmenting the skills of healthcare professionals.
